Nelly, born Cornell Iral Haynes Jr., is a renowned American rapper, singer, and songwriter. While he is best known for his successful music career, Nelly has also ventured into acting, appearing in several movies throughout his career.
Movie Title | Year | Nelly’s Role |
---|---|---|
Snipes | 2001 | Prolifik |
The Longest Yard | 2005 | Earl Megget |
Reach Me | 2014 | E-Ruption |
Nelly made his acting debut in the 2001 comedy-drama film “Snipes,” where he played the role of Prolifik, a talented rapper. The movie follows the story of Erik Triggs (Sam Jones III), a young man who aspires to become a successful rapper like his idol, Prolifik.
In 2005, Nelly appeared in the sports comedy film “The Longest Yard,” alongside Adam Sandler and Chris Rock. He portrayed Earl Megget, a former football player who joins a team of inmates in a match against the prison guards. The movie was a box office success and helped showcase Nelly’s acting skills to a wider audience.
Nelly played the character of E-Ruption in the 2014 drama film “Reach Me.” The movie features an ensemble cast and explores the lives of several individuals who are connected through a self-help book written by a reclusive author. Although Nelly’s role was relatively small, it demonstrated his ability to take on more serious acting roles.
